Transportation (TR1) – Mankisha Health Services LLC

Program Description

Mankisha Health Services LLC provides Transportation (TR1) services under the Arizona Division of Developmental Disabilities (DDD). This service ensures that members have safe, reliable, and accessible transportation to and from authorized services and community activities as outlined in their Individual Support Plan (ISP). Transportation supports community integration by connecting members to employment, day programs, medical appointments, habilitation services, and other essential activities.


Service Model

  • Service Scope: Transportation is provided only to and from DDD-authorized services and activities.
  • Vehicles: All company vehicles are well-maintained, insured, and comply with Arizona safety regulations. Vehicles are equipped to meet the accessibility needs of members, including wheelchair access when required.
  • Staffing: Drivers are trained in first aid, CPR, member rights, and emergency procedures, and must maintain a valid Arizona driver’s license with a clean driving record.
  • Scheduling: Transportation is coordinated in advance, per the member’s ISP and service schedule, with flexibility to meet individual needs.

Member Support Areas

  • Access to Services: Reliable transportation to employment, habilitation, medical, and therapy appointments.
  • Community Inclusion: Opportunities to attend community, recreational, or social activities when approved by the ISP.
  • Safety & Comfort: Members receive assistance with entering/exiting vehicles, seatbelts, securing mobility devices, and safe travel.
  • Consistency: Transportation schedules align with work, supported living, and day program hours to ensure continuity of care.

Mankisha Staff Responsibilities

  • Provide safe, timely, and respectful transportation services.
  • Assist members in boarding, exiting, and securing themselves or mobility devices in vehicles.
  • Maintain communication with program staff, families, and support coordinators to coordinate schedules.
  • Ensure vehicles are inspected daily for safety and cleanliness.
  • Document trips, mileage, and any incidents in accordance with DDD requirements.
  • Uphold member dignity, privacy, and rights during transport.
